Siphiwe Tshabalala set to leave Kaizer Chiefs
Shabba confirms Steaua, Olympiakos interest

Bafana Bafana left-winger Siphiwe Tshabalala has admitted that top Greek side Olympiakos are chasing his services.
As KickOff.com reported on Friday, the Kaizer Chiefs man says he is also aware of the strong interest from Romanian side Steaua Bucharest, and that he would be interested in moving to the Eastern European club if they could match Chiefs' valuation of him.
The 25-year-old has been the subject of intense media speculation since scoring a cracking opening goal for Bafana in their 1-1 draw with Mexico at the World Cup, and he says there have been offers from across Europe.
“We received offers from France, Greece, Holland and England, and I think I would like to sign there,” Tshabalala told Romanian newspaper Gazette Sports. “I have proposed terms that I would be happy with and I have discussed these with my agent. Nothing has been decided yet; we need to have more discussions, but I hope to have everything sorted out this week.
“The Greece offer is a strong one. I know it’s Olympiakos, but we'll see what happens. My goal is to go to one of Greece, France, England or Romania and to play as much as I can and help my new team!”
Olympiakos finished a disappointing fifth in the Greek championship last season; this after they won the title five times in a row between 2005 and 2009. They have just, however, signed Spanish left-winger Albert Rieira from Liverpool, which may make a move for Tshabalala unlikely.
But the player says he would also welcome the chance to play for Steaua.
“From what I read I know that Steaua won the Champions League [old European Cup] in 1986 and has very good players. Honestly, I thought it was a joke when I heard about their interest. It's an important club with European experience,” Tshabalala says.
"The World Cup was good in helping me to find a club in Europe. My goal now is to reach an ambitious team, a strong team, where I can show my qualities."
